Workforce & Industrial Development

Nestled in the Appalachian region of eastern Kentucky, Millstone is gaining attention as a strategic location for industrial and logistics investments. The city benefits from its proximity to US Highway 119 and the Mountain Parkway, providing efficient access to regional and interstate markets. Letcher County’s ongoing infrastructure upgrades, including improved roadways and broadband expansion, are making the area increasingly attractive for manufacturers and distribution centers seeking cost-effective sites.

Industrial real estate activity in Millstone and the greater Letcher County area is supported by a network of local and regional partners. The Kentucky Cabinet for Economic Development offers a suite of incentives, including tax credits and workforce training grants, to support new and expanding businesses. Meanwhile, the Southeast Kentucky Economic Development (SKED) organization provides site selection assistance and financing options tailored to the unique needs of Appalachian industries.

Workforce development remains a local priority. Partnerships with Southeast Kentucky Community & Technical College and regional workforce boards ensure a pipeline of skilled labor in advanced manufacturing, logistics, and energy sectors. These initiatives, combined with Kentucky’s competitive business climate and supportive local leadership, position Millstone as a promising destination for industrial growth.
